# Skill: Execute Project

**Purpose**: Systematically execute project work with continuous progress tracking and task completion validation.

**Load When**:
- User says: "execute project [ID/name]"
- User says: "continue [project-name]"
- User says: "work on [project-name]"
- Orchestrator detects: Project continuation (IN_PROGRESS status)

**Core Value**: Ensures work stays aligned with planned tasks and provides continuous visibility into progress.

---

## Quick Reference

**What This Skill Does**:
1. ✅ Loads project context (planning files, current progress)
2. ✅ Identifies current phase/section and next uncompleted task
3. ✅ Executes work systematically (section-by-section or task-by-task)
4. ✅ Continuously updates task completion using bulk-complete-tasks.py
5. ✅ Validates progress after each section/checkpoint
6. ✅ Handles pause-and-resume gracefully
7. ✅ Auto-triggers close-session when done

**Key Scripts Used**:
- `nexus-loader.py --project [ID]` - Load project context
- `bulk-complete-tasks.py --project [ID] --section [N]` - Complete section
- `bulk-complete-tasks.py --project [ID] --tasks [range]` - Complete specific tasks
- `bulk-complete-tasks.py --project [ID] --all` - Complete all (when project done)

---

## Prerequisites

**Before using this skill, ensure**:
- ✅ Project exists in `02-projects/` with valid metadata
- ✅ Planning files exist: `overview.md`, `plan.md` (or `design.md`), `steps.md` (or `tasks.md`)
- ✅ Tasks file has checkbox format: `- [ ] Task description`
- ✅ Project status is `IN_PROGRESS` or `PLANNING` (ready to execute)

**If prerequisites not met**:
- Missing project → Use `create-project` skill first
- Missing planning → Complete planning phase before execution
- Invalid task format → Validate with `validate-system` skill

## Workflow: 7-Step Execution Process

### Step 1: Initialize Progress Tracking

**Action**: Create comprehensive TodoWrite with ALL workflow steps

**Template**:
```markdown
1. Load project context
2. Identify current phase/section
3. Execute Section 1
4. Bulk-complete Section 1
5. Execute Section 2
6. Bulk-complete Section 2
... (repeat for all sections)
N. Project completion validation
N+1. Trigger close-session
```

**Purpose**: Provides user visibility into entire execution workflow

**Mark complete when**: TodoWrite created with all steps

---

### Step 2: Load Project Context

**Action**: Load complete project context using nexus-loader.py

**Commands**:
```bash
# Load project with full content (overview, plan, steps, etc.)
python 00-system/core/nexus-loader.py --project [project-id]
```

**The loader returns**:
- File paths for all planning files (overview.md, plan.md, steps.md, etc.)
- YAML metadata extracted from each file
- Output file listings
- `_usage.recommended_reads` - list of paths to read

**Then use Read tool in parallel** to load the file contents:
```
Read: {path from recommended_reads[0]}
Read: {path from recommended_reads[1]}
Read: {path from recommended_reads[2]}
```

**Display Project Summary**:
```
━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━
PROJECT: [Project Name]
━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━

Status: IN_PROGRESS
Progress: [X]/[Y] tasks complete ([Z]%)

Current Section: Section [N] - [Name]
Next Task: [Task description]

━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━━
```

**Mark complete when**: All planning files loaded, summary displayed

---

### Step 3: Identify Current Phase

**Action**: Parse tasks file to determine current state

**Detection Logic**:
```python
# Parse tasks.md or steps.md
tasks = extract_all_tasks(content)
sections = extract_sections(content)

# Find first uncompleted section
current_section = find_first_uncompleted_section(sections, tasks)

# Find next uncompleted task
next_task = find_next_uncompleted_task(tasks)

# Calculate progress
total_tasks = len(tasks)
completed_tasks = count_completed(tasks)
progress_pct = (completed_tasks / total_tasks) * 100
```

## Advanced Features

### Adaptive Granularity

**Auto-detects project size and adjusts tracking granularity**:

```python
# Small projects (≤15 tasks)
→ Task-by-task execution with real-time updates

# Medium projects (16-30 tasks, with sections)
→ Section-based execution with bulk-complete per section

# Large projects (>30 tasks, with sections)
→ Section-based with periodic checkpoints (every 5-7 tasks)

# Unstructured projects (no sections)
→ Checkpoint every 10 tasks
```

### Error Handling

**Common Issues**:

**Issue**: Tasks file not found
**Solution**: Validate project structure with `validate-system` skill

**Issue**: No uncompleted tasks
**Solution**: Display "All tasks complete!" and offer to mark project COMPLETE

**Issue**: Invalid task format (no checkboxes)
**Solution**: Show error with example format: `- [ ] Task description`

**Issue**: Bulk-complete script fails
**Solution**: Fallback to manual Edit tool, log error for debugging
